Position Type:Support Staff/Special Education AssistantDate Posted:4/8/2025Location:Exceptional Learners CollaborativeDate Available:8/7/25District:Exceptional Learners CollaborativeSpecial Education Paraprofessional (2025-2026 School Year)Special Education Paraprofessional - The Exceptional Learners Collaborative (ELC) is seeking exceptional certified paraprofessional applicants for the 2025-2026 school year. This position is a full time 10-month role. The ELC is located in Vernon Hills (Lake County), Illinois; is a special education cooperative providing services to students identified with special needs, ages 3 through 22 years of age. The ELC represents Kildeer Countryside Community Consolidated School District 96, Lincolnshire-Prairie View School District 103, Adlai E. Stevenson High School District 125 and Fox Lake District 114. The ELC serves eight elementary schools, four junior high/middle schools and one high school.Work Location:Exceptional Learners CollaborativeEssential Duties and Responsibilities:The paraprofessional will assist special education students with daily routines that ensure student access to curriculum including schoolwork, homework, test preparation, mobility, transitions activities and daily medical/safety needs. The paraprofessional will be expected to work collaboratively with certified staff and administration. Paraprofessionals will support teacher implementation of daily classroom programming including administrative support as requested. Paraprofessional support includes but is not limited to any of the following: Assiststudents with academic support in a variety of academic and social settings. Assist students during community based instruction as directed by certified staff. Assist students will following daily schedules and routines. Assist students with toileting and hygiene as necessary. Assist students with mobility throughout the school setting. Assist students with transitions within the classroom and in the hallways. Assist students to ensure medical safety. Assist students with feeding as necessary. Assist teacher with monitoring student behavior during structured and unstructured settings. Asist in the development of study materials and/or modification of work. Support student use of technology. Transport students for community based experiences including mobility trips and work sites. Provide safety needs for all students. Provide job coaching for on site and community based work sites. Participate in student meetings as directed by supervisor. Participate and engage in on-site professional development. Participate and assist in therapy sessions in collaboration with certified staff.
